1862 London Exhibition: Catalogue: Class V.: Charles Little

From Graces Guide

1267. LITTLE, CHARLES, 71 Little Horton Lane, Bradford.

Safety coupling for railway waggons.

By means of this invention, much of the danger to human life attending the ordinary method of coupling, is obviated; and time is saved in the marshalling of railway trains. Some of these couplings are in use by the Midland, Great Northern, Manchester, Sheffield and Lincolnshire, and other railway companies.
